This patchset moves bmcweb over to the upstream style naming
conventions for variables, classes, and functions, as well as imposes
the latest clang-format file.
This changeset was mostly built automatically by the included
.clang-tidy file, which has the ability to autoformat and auto rename
variables. At some point in the future I would like to see this in
greater use, but for now, we will impose it on bmcweb, and see how it
goes.
Tested: Code still compiles, and appears to run, although other issues
are possible and likely.

This commit is the beginings of attempting to transition away from
crow, and toward boost::beast. Unit tests are passing, and
implementation appears to be slightly faster than crow.

Upate get_routes to use the correct constness for its use case
crow to set json_mode if json value is populated
Delete std::array bytes API due to major efficiency issues. To be
replaced with span API in near future
Implement a catch block for handlers that can throw exceptions
Implement direct handling of routes that end with / to better support
redfish.
/foo and /foo/ now invoke the same handler insead of issuing a 301
redirect
Update nlohmann to latest version
Implement one nlohmann endpoint with exceptions disabled
Implement first pass at a IBM style rest-dbus interface
Fix pam authentication to call dropbear auth methods
Implements first pass at redfish interface. Shemas avaialble pass
redfish validation 100%
Use response json object rather than request json object.
Update authorization middleware to be redfish compliant
UPdate random token generation to be more efficient, and not base64
bytes, generate bytes directly
